AT_abc050_b [ABC050B] Contest with Drinks Easy
题目描述
joisino お姉ちゃん即将参加某编程竞赛的决赛。在这场竞赛中,共有 $N$ 道题目,这些题目编号为 $1$ 到 $N$。joisino お姉ちゃん知道,解第 $i$ 道题目($1 \leq i \leq N$)需要 $T_i$ 秒。
此外,本次竞赛提供了 $M$ 种饮料,编号为 $1$ 到 $M$。如果喝下第 $i$ 种饮料($1 \leq i \leq M$),大脑会被刺激,解第 $P_i$ 道题目所需的时间会变为 $X_i$ 秒。解其他题目的时间不会发生变化。
参赛者在比赛开始前只能选择喝一瓶饮料。joisino お姉ちゃん想知道,对于每种饮料,如果喝下它,解完所有题目所需的总时间是多少。总时间指的是解每道题目所需时间的总和。你的任务是帮 joisino お姉ちゃん计算出每种饮料对应的总时间。
输入格式
输入以以下格式从标准输入给出。
> $N$
> $T_1\ T_2\ \ldots\ T_N$
> $M$
> $P_1\ X_1$
> $P_2\ X_2$
> $\vdots$
> $P_M\ X_M$
输出格式
对于每种饮料,输出喝下该饮料后解完所有题目所需的总时间,每行输出一个答案。
说明/提示
### 限制条件
- 所有输入均为整数。
- $1 \leq N \leq 100$
- $1 \leq T_i \leq 10^5$
- $1 \leq M \leq 100$
- $1 \leq P_i \leq N$
- $1 \leq X_i \leq 10^5$
### 样例解释 1
如果喝下第一种饮料,每道题目所需时间分别为 $1$ 秒、$1$ 秒、$4$ 秒。它们的总和为 $6$ 秒,因此输出 $6$。
如果喝下第二种饮料,每道题目所需时间分别为 $2$ 秒、$3$ 秒、$4$ 秒。它们的总和为 $9$ 秒,因此输出 $9$。
由 ChatGPT 4.1 翻译